J&K court acquits couple accused of illegal entry from Pakistan, says “POK an integral part of India”
A Judicial Magistrate court in Chadoora has acquitted a Budgam couple booked under the Enemy Agents Ordinance and the Foreigners Act, ruling that Pakistan-occupied Kashmir is an integral part of India and that the Foreigners Act cannot be invoked without clear and reliable proof of foreign nationality or illegal entry, Bar & Bench reported.
